Job Summary
The Associate online visual designer is responsible for creating design assets to optimize product content for Lowe’s PDP. The role ensures consistent, repeatable design execution while aligning with business objectives and customer needs.
This role requires strong foundational skills in visual design, layout, color, and composition, along with hands-on experience using tools such as Adobe Photoshop, Premiere Pro, and Figma.
The Associate online visual designer is expected to be detail-oriented, collaborative, and open to feedback, with a willingness to learn new tools, technologies, and emerging design trends, including AI-driven creative solutions. By supporting team deliverables and contributing to day-to-day production needs, the Associate Designer plays a key role in delivering high-quality digital content that supports Lowe’s e-commerce growth and customer engagement.
Job Description
• Create and edit high-quality digital images for digital and marketing use, ensuring adherence to brand and quality standards.
• Edit video content including promos, ads, and long-format videos using Adobe Premiere Pro; support basic motion graphics requirements.
• Support design execution in Figma, including layouts, visual components, and design updates as per creative briefs.
• Assist in pre-production and post-production workflows, including multi-camera video sync, resolution management, and format optimization.
• Apply working knowledge of typography, color theory, color correction, and visual composition across image and video assets.
• Upload, organize, and manage creative assets on designated internal platforms or DAM systems, following naming conventions and metadata standards.
• Prepare presentations and creative decks with raw ideas, references, and initial concepts for internal reviews.
• Ensure accuracy, consistency, and timely delivery of creative outputs across multiple projects.
• Collaborate with designers, managers, and cross-functional stakeholders to meet project timelines and requirements.
• Continuously improve skills by learning new tools, shortcuts, workflows, and emerging digital design trends.
Years of Experience:
2+ Years in any E-commerce, creative design, UX UI, Product Design related field
Education Qualification & Certifications (optional)
• Graduate in any Visual Design, Fine arts, UI/UX Design, Product Design.
• Preference will be given to candidates with Certification in Adobe Creative Suite.
• Preference will be given to candidates with certification in website design for E-commerce/retail industries.
Skills required:
• Strong E-commerce, online/omnichannel retail experience
• Good Communication Skills
• A portfolio that demonstrates photography, editing, and design capabilities
• Demonstrated understanding of design/color applied in layout, design, and image composition
• Experience in Adobe CS including Photoshop, Premier Pro.
• Figma Design experience
• Content Writing and typography
• Moderate Excel and Microsoft Office Applications

Specialist Software Engineer - Informatica - (26000CCZ)
Missions
Develop code and test case scenarios by applying relevant software craftsmanship principles and meet the acceptance criteria.
Complete the assigned learning path and contribute to daily meetings.
Deliver on all aspects of Software Development Lifecyle (SDLC) in-line with Agile and IT craftsmanship principles.
Take part in team ceremonies be it agile practices or chapter meetings.
Deliver high-quality clean code and design that can be re-used.
Actively, work with other Development teams to define and implement API's and rules for data access.
Perform bug-free release validations and produce test and defect reports.
Contribute to developing scripts, configuring quality and automating framework usage.
Run and maintain test suites with the guidance of seniors.
Support existing data models, data dictionary, data pipeline standards, storage of source, process and consumer metadata.
Profile
Experience :3+ years
Java Bigdata - Intermediate level
Angular : Intermediate
Big data : Intermediate
Docker, Kubernetes - Intermediate
Spring MVC- Intermediate
Rest services - Advanced
PL/SQL - Intermediate
Testing (Unit Testing, writing automated test scripts) - Required
CI/CD pipeline – Advanced
Experience in Agile methodology
Nice to Have but not Mandatory
UX - Added Advantage
JIRA - Added advantage
Behavioral
• Proven communication skills (spoken and written) to interact with on & off-shore teams with multi-cultural environment.
• Should be a quick learner, adapt to change, pro-active & self driven.
• Strong analytical skills and proven numerical skills.
• Keen sense of quality and client orientation
• Should be flexible to work from different locations and different timings.
